Smile My HOME THEATER is Now Complete!

So literally after well over a year and a half of searching for potential ideas for my entryway and that final piece for my Home Theater setup, I finally had to create one, sort of.

You see, I have sooooo many Movies that I like that I simply could not put a single Movie Poster at the entrance. And obviously there are none inside the theater due to glare. But I wanted something that was tasteful, exemplified what Theaters are all about (or should be) and of course unique. I have literally scoured the web and reached out to various entities for specific pieces/images that I wanted most. All were dead ends. Including the likes of eBay, Amazon, etc.
So what I did was locate a few images of Sound Labs/Studios that are synonymous with the epic sound quality of Movies: DOLBY, DTS, THX. I carefully combined these images into one using photoshop (spacing, contrast, sharpen, etc) that I could then print out and frame. The result? My perfect and final piece to be seen entering and leaving our Theater.
It is 27x40 and perfectly centered and mounted.
